Introduction:
Established in 1912, Bank of China is one of the largest banks in the world, with over $3 trillion in assets and a footprint that spans more than 60 countries and regions. Our long-term outlook, institutional weight and global breadth provide our clients with a stable and reliable financial partner, whether in Corporate or Personal Banking or our Trade Services, Commodities, Financial Institutions and Global Markets lines of business.
Overview:
This position will monitor and handle payments and invoices for the Bank. Main responsibilities include but not limited to reviewing, verifying, reconciling invoices and reimbursements/payments, processing accounts payable related transactions, maintaining payment records and performing expense analysis to ensure processes performed align with Bank’s procedure, policy guidelines, standards, and regulatory requirements.
